Biography

Mercy Cooke was born in 1657 in Plymouth, Plymouth Colony, the child of jean john cooke and sarah warren. Mercy Cooke married stephen west. Mercy Cooke passed away in 1733 in Dartmouth, Bristol, Provience of Massachusetts Bay.
